    1. Pay attention to the agreement on the payment of the house: Before receiving the house, the owner needs to carefully check the agreement on the payment in the contract. If there is a clear agreement in the contract that all the house payments must be paid before the house can be collected, then the owner must prepare sufficient funds before receiving the house, so as to successfully collect the house.

    2. Pay attention to the first inspection of the house and then go through the procedures: on the day of delivery, the owners should not rush to handle the delivery procedures as soon as they arrive in the community, once the procedures are completed, it is difficult to solve the quality problems existing in the house. Therefore, it is recommended that you should inspect the house first, and then go through the procedures.

    During the home inspection, the problems found should be recorded in writing and then submitted to the real estate developer to avoid disputes in the future.

    3. It is recommended that the owners collectively collect the house and return to the house: due to the fact that there are many matters to collect the house, and it involves some professional matters, it is recommended that the owners in the community can collect the house collectively, and when collecting the house, they can also ask professional personnel to accompany them, so that they can better protect their own rights and interests in case of problems.

    Nowadays, the second-hand housing market is hot, and many buyers will choose to buy second-hand houses, but when we carry out the delivery of second-hand housing properties, if we do not pay attention, it is easy to have various disputes, which endanger their own interests. So what are the precautions for the handover of second-hand housing properties? Next, I will briefly introduce it to you.

    1. When the second-hand house property is delivered, we need to pay attention to whether the various expenses of the house are settled clearly. Before handing over the house, the buyer can ask for the bill of the relevant expenses such as water bills, nuclear power bills, gas bills, limited TV receipts and vouchers that have been paid in the previous month, and make sure that the seller's various living expenses have been paid. Buyers can ask the seller to assist with repairs**, name changes, gas, limited TV transfer procedures.

    2. When buying and selling second-hand houses, some sellers will promise to give away furniture and household appliances. You can accept the attached home appliances and furniture according to the contract. When the property is delivered, we also need to pay attention to the acceptance of the ancillary facilities and equipment of the house, such as whether the equipment is damaged, whether the sewer is blocked, and whether the meter is moved or modified.

    3. When the second-hand house property is delivered, we must pay attention to the problem of household registration. Many buyers buy second-hand houses in order to settle down and go to school, so the seller's failure to move out of the household registration will harm the interests of buyers. The day before the delivery date, the buyer can go to the police station to find out whether the seller's account has moved out.

    4. When you buy a second-hand house, it is best to leave a balance payment as a property delivery deposit, if the seller is in arrears of property fees, water and electricity bills, etc., we can directly use this deposit to pay the outstanding fees. When signing the contract, you can agree on the time of account migration, the seller's liability for breach of contract and other relevant terms in the contract.

    1. Notice: After obtaining the real estate certificate of commercial housing, the developer shall notify the buyer of the handover, and the notice shall be in written form and clearly state the handover time. The time limit for the developer to take over the building should be within one month after the handover is completed, and the notice of repossession is sent, in accordance with the relevant legal provisions.

    If the buyer fails to go through the relevant procedures at the designated place within the agreed time, it will be deemed that the developer has actually delivered the house to the buyer. 2. Acceptance: Buyers should inspect the quality of housing projects and supporting facilities in a timely manner, and make records.

    During the acceptance, the buyer should verify the corresponding real estate certificate of the commercial housing and the quality inspection certificate of the construction project. 3. Provide relevant documents: The developer should provide relevant documents including the "Residential Quality Assurance Certificate" and the "Residential Instruction Manual".

    If the developer does not provide these documents, the buyer can refuse to sign the handover letter. 4. Sign the house handover letter: When the buyer inspects the house and its property rights, he can sign the house handover letter in accordance with the relevant regulations, make a record of the need to make a record of the non-compliance with the contract, and require the developer to sign until the delivery conditions fully meet the delivery standards, and then sign the house handover letter.

    n Pay attention to things when handing over the house: 1. Whether there is water leakage on the roof, doors, windows, walls and other places, or whether there are residual stains. If there are any problems, it means that there are problems in the waterproof function of the house 2, whether the doors and windows can be opened and closed smoothly, whether there is deformation, locking and other phenomena, pay attention to whether the quality of the doors and windows is qualified.

    For the anti-theft door, it is necessary to check whether the doorbell is normal 3, the wall and ground should also be carefully checked, you can use a small hammer to beat, if there is a hollow drum or cracking, it means that there is a serious quality problem on the wall and ground. 4. Pay special attention to whether the flue of the kitchen and bathroom is blocked. During the inspection, the waste paper can be ignited to observe if there is any gas coming out of the smoke exhaust port.

    If it cannot be discharged, you should contact the developer in time. 5. The bathroom should also be inspected for waterproofing. You can use river sand to block the sewer mouth, and then continuously inject a large amount of water, and observe whether there is a water flow spreading downstairs after 2 hours, if not, it proves that the waterproof is good.

    N6. The owner also needs to bring his own small lamp, which can be inserted into the circuit jack during the house inspection to check whether there is a point and whether the small lamp is on. When plugging in the small lights, you also need to close the switches in the switch box to see if the switches are running as usual. 7. It is also very important to record the three meters of water and electricity in the house.

    The new house is what people are looking forward to, and there are some steps to go through before the formal decoration and occupancy, among which the property inspection is a more important link. Presumably, many people don't know much about this, so let's take a look at the property inspection process and the precautions for property inspection.

    First, the property inspection process.

    1. Electrical box inspection: The electrical box is one of the important parts of the whole electrician's acceptance, and the inspection of the electrical box mainly includes the inspection of installation standards, appearance inspection and the inspection of the structure of the electrical box.

    2. Switch and socket inspection: when checking the switch, focus on checking whether the appearance of the switch is damaged, and whether the corresponding electrical appliances are running and seepage is good. When inspecting the socket, it is also necessary to check the appearance first, and then check whether the socket is wired correctly through the electroscope.

    3. Drainage engineering inspection: The acceptance of drainage engineering should include quality inspection and drainage inspection. The quality of floor drains, drains and drainage pipes must be strictly controlled, and the drainage must be checked to see if it is normal.

    4. Wall inspection: Generally, it is necessary to check whether the color of the wall is uniform and smooth, and whether there are cracks. Use a vertical inspection ruler to detect the verticality and horizontality of the wall.

    5. Door and window installation and acceptance: The acceptance of doors and windows is mainly through appearance inspection, frame inspection, door and window lock inspection and opening inspection.

    2. Precautions for property inspection.

    1. When accepting the ground, you need to use a long ruler, leaning against the wall and ground, check whether it is flat, and observe whether there are scratches and cracks, and whether the wall has a burst point.

    2. While checking whether the wall is smooth, it is also necessary to see whether the wall has cracks, whether there are leaking barbed wire and steel bars.

    3. Here mainly depends on the flatness of the stairs and whether there are defects. This is also for the sake of safety considerations for future use.

    4. In addition to checking the stability of doors and windows, it is also necessary to check whether the installation track of doors and windows is smooth. In particular, the vertical code is the pro-casement window, and you must pay attention to whether it can be closed tightly.

    3. What should I do if the house inspection is unqualified?

    What should I do if I find any non-conformities during the inspection? First of all, it is necessary to obtain the developer's signature and seal in writing, and pay attention to keeping the evidence, ask the developer to deal with it in a timely manner, and do not collect the key before the problem is resolved.

    Fourth, can I check out if the house inspection is not qualified?

    As for whether a house that is not qualified can be checked out, it mainly depends on the severity of the failure. If the quality of the house seriously affects the normal residential use, and the buyer requests to move out and ask the developer to compensate for the loss, the court will also support it. However, if it is a more common situation that can be repaired, it can generally be handled by the developer, and it is not possible to just check out.
